Itinerary
1
Monument a Francesc Macia
Visit the striking Monument dedicated to Francesc Macià and uncover the architect’s hidden message. Explore how its bold design captures the spirit of Catalan heritage and leadership.
2
Avenue Del Portal De L'angel
Explore Avinguda del Portal de l’Àngel, once a bustling textile hub, now a vibrant haven for global brands.
3
Santa Anna Church
Discover the 12th-century Church of Santa Anna in Barcelona and admire its Romanesque-Gothic architecture, a timeless treasure of the city’s spiritual heritage.
4
Els 4Gats
Visit the historic restaurant once frequented by Antoni Gaudí, Pablo Picasso, and Ramon Casas i Carbó.
5
Font de Santa Anna
Visit the 14th-century Font de Santa Anna, once a humble watering trough for travelers’ horses.
6
Col.legi d'Arquitectes de Catalunya
Visit the Col·legi d'Arquitectes de Catalunya and behold one of Picasso’s largest masterpieces—absolutely free.
7
La Casa de l'Ardiaca
Visit the 15th-century residence of Archdeacon Lluís Desplà to uncover the symbolism behind its letterbox and the whimsical “dancing egg.”
8
Barcelona Cathedral
Visit the majestic Barcelona Cathedral to delve into its storied history and architectural splendor. Uncover the tale of Saint Eulalia and the 13 geese that keep her memory alive within these sacred walls.
9
Monument to the martyrs of independence
Visit the Monument to the Heroes of 1809 and discover the dramatic events that shaped Barcelona’s past.
10
Placa Sant Felip Neri
Visit Plaça de Sant Felip Neri, where the walls still bear the scars of the 1938 bombings.
11
Pont del Bisbe
Walk past the Pont del Bisbe and uncover the legend of Saint Jordi, the dragon-slaying knight.
12
MUHBA Temple d'August
Visit the 2,000-year-old Temple of Augustus, one of Barcelona’s oldest and most hidden treasures.
13
Basílica dels Sants Màrtirs Just i Pastor
Visit the Basilica of Saints Justus and Pastor, one of Barcelona’s oldest churches, rich in history and legend.
14
Palau de la Generalitat de Catalunya
Visit the Parliament of Catalonia, a historic landmark in the heart of Barcelona’s Gothic Quarter.
